as the hp goes up so does the rpms. the motor i have is about 400 hp probly a little less at the wheels and a little more at the crank. 383 stroke is my next move. stall is a must if auto. you have obd2 so should take a look at the ls1 motors, 450 is easier to get from them. i would recomend you look at what sam strano has and if interested give a call, one of the best suspension guys in the country, also i would recomend elliots heads, cam and intake, he is also very good at helping to get the most out of the lt1. 11.5 compression in a lt1 is good with pump gas, can go 12 as well, lt1 likes high compression. anyways do alot of looking before jumping. check my build

LE can get you close to your goals.

I do not believe you can use the 3 point SFC and relocated torque arm together as they use the same mounting points.

You don't need 42 lbs injectors. 36 lb should be fine.

Spark plugs depend on what compression you go with.

Clutch, I'm not sure on as I drive auto.

Skip on the LT4 KS...it is the same as the LT1.

Double roller timing chain? I didn't think they made one that'll work with the opti.

What are your goals as far as a "track" car? Road course, Auto X, drag?
